Anyone else not that worried after these last two losses?

I’ve been thinking about these last two losses a lot, especially the Courage game, and honestly I’m still not that worried about the Spirit yet. Obviously losing two straight at home sucks, and going down 3-0 in 15 minutes absolutely cannot happen, but I also feel like it’s really easy to overlook the positives when the final result is a loss.

We literally fought back from 3-0 to 3-3 and were inches away from potentially making it 4-3 with Hal’s shot off the post. If we had held onto the draw, I feel like the conversation around that game would be completely different even though 99% of the performance would’ve been exactly the same.

My biggest concern honestly isn’t even the two losses themselves. It’s how predictable our attack has become. It feels like teams know we’re going to progress down one of the wings and then look for the pass centrally. Sometimes we get right outside the box with a decent shooting opportunity and instead pass it around looking for the perfect chance until the defense gets completely organized. I’d love to see us attack through the middle more, take more shots when the opportunity is there, and just give defenses more things to think about.

I also think we sometimes get too conservative once we have a lead. Obviously you don’t want to play recklessly when you’re up 2-0, but I also don’t want the other team knowing that we’re basically going to put it in park. Make them worry that if they start throwing numbers forward, we might make it 3-0.

Saturday actually showed me the mentality I want to see more often. Once we were down 3-0, suddenly there was urgency, players were taking chances, and we became much harder to defend. Obviously you can’t play with that level of risk all the time, but I’d love to see that same decisiveness without needing to go three goals down first lol.

There are definitely things to fix, especially defensively, and these last two results hurt. But with 11 games left, I’m nowhere near ready to say this team isn’t a contender anymore. I think the response over the next few games is going to tell us a lot.
